## Acceptance objective

Require search evidence before deletion and rollback clarity after deletion.

## Hard gates

1. Repository, registry, configuration, dynamic, generated, and external-consumer searches support the unused classification.
2. Deletion is limited to proven candidates and does not remove compatibility or feature-gated paths without authority.
3. Build, tests, reference scans, and recovery information are complete after removal.

## Evidence requirements

- Per-symbol search evidence and classification.
- Deletion diff, regression outputs, generated-artifact checks, and rollback route.
